Ok, here we go. I started with doing research. I decided to make a snekkja. I apologize for the quality of the image, but that is what my ipad's got.

17 inches long, 0.5 inches deep, and 2 inches at the widest point. That is Angrislaug for comparison to the initial frame.

Does any one have any suggestion for the wood? I plan on either Balsa or (the mych cheaper alternative) popsicle sticks.
